Output dbfcd5f20617f7e9515d1950098580d68d3d26dc2486747121cc58c7c083b150:3

value
5858376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f610ae3e24d5498a5d5baa19dc927362468ebec4 OP_EQUAL
address
3Q868izuZowhsSXXiLVS8xTNSGJinNzRJi
transaction
dbfcd5f20617f7e9515d1950098580d68d3d26dc2486747121cc58c7c083b150
spent
true